Guys!

Can Big Lake Regulars tell me the time dfference on tides being shown at the Cameron Jettings to say place such as the old jetties, Commissary, Turners. Say low is at 9 AM at the Cameron Jetties? What time will it be low at the place mentioned.

I know wind Etc. will place a part!!

Depends on the strength of tides and the winds...if you have a strong incoming and a strong south wind the tides will move in faster...so figure 45min to an hour to reach old jetty's, and add an hour to each...commissary and turners! So a strong in should make it to turners 3 hours (aprox) after it turns in @ the Jetty's! If you have a strong in predicted and a 20mph N wind you may never see the in coming tide @ all at the above mentioned...Hope this makes some sense!!!
